Specifications
| AWG | 6 AWG (133/.0142) SRG-ML |
|---|---|
| Conductor Stranding | 133/.0142 |
| Insulation Thickness | .063 |
| Braid | .010 |
| Outside Diameter | .353 |
| Ampacity | 135 |
| Weight Per 1000' | 133 |
| UL Style | 3278 |
| Temperature Rating | 150°C |
